How they compare

Ukraine currently reports 90.6% against 89.6% in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, a difference of 1.0%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Ukraine ahead.

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 98th and Ukraine ranks 95th of 187 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Bolivia, Plurinational State of averaged higher in 1 and Ukraine in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bolivia, Plurinational State of Ukraine Difference Ahead
1990s 62.9% 95.2% 32.3% Ukraine
2000s 89.1% 96.1% 6.9% Ukraine
2010s 87.6% 98.4% 10.8% Ukraine
2020s 89.6% 87.9% 1.7% Bolivia, Plurinational State of

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Lower secondary education completion rate is measured as the gross intake ratio to the last grade of lower secondary education (general and pre-vocational). It is calculated as the number of new entrants in the last grade of lower secondary education, regardless of age, divided by the population at the entrance age for the last grade of lower secondary education.
